Distance From Kabori Airstrip to Warsaw Chopin Airport

The distance from Kabori Airstrip () to Warsaw Chopin Airport (WAW) is 7677 miles or 12355 kilometers or 6667 nautical miles.

How long does it take to travel from Kabori ( Papua New Guinea ) to Warsaw ( Poland )?

A one-way nonstop (direct) flight between Kabori and Warsaw takes around 17 hours 39 minutes.
Estimated flight time from Kabori Airstrip, Kabori, Papua New Guinea to Warsaw Chopin Airport, Warsaw, Poland is 17 hours 39 minutes under avarage conditions. Your actual flying time may vary depending on wind direction/speed or weather conditions. This calculation does not include the departure and landing times of the aircraft. In addition, it does not cover the person identity check, ticket check-in and baggage collection times at the airport.

Time Difference Between the Airports • - WAW

Time difference between Kabori (Papua New Guinea) and Warsaw (Poland) is 9 Hours.
Warsaw time is 9 Hours behind Kabori.

Why should you arrive 3 hours before international flight? Flyers who are traveling to an international destination should arrive at the airport earlier than domestic flyers. This is because international flights can have additional check-in requirements, like passport verification, that need to be completed before you receive your boarding pass.
